Enough! It is the birthright and duty of Believers to make the righteous judgment! None should judge from prejudice or presumption, but if I see a man actively sinning and I say to him, repent you sinner for the Kingdom of Heaven is near and he repents, did I love him by telling him the truth and having his soul spared on the Day of Judgment? Nevertheless, if I see the same man doing a sin that SCRIPTURE has already deemed unrighteous and I say nothing and that man dies in his sin, did I love him when Father finds him guilty and his soul perishes, and if SCRIPTURE has deemed His deed unrighteous, then by agreeing with SCRIPTURE why is my judgment called wicked? If I do not warn him will not his blood be on my hands? Why then do you say dont judge? It is written: [1Co 6:5 KJV] 5 I speak to your shame. Is it so, that there is not a wise man among you? no, not one that shall be able to JUDGE between his brethren? It is written: [1Co 5:3 NLT] 3 Even though I am not with you in person, I am with you in the Spirit. And as though I were there, I have already passed judgment on this man. It is written: [Pro 27:5 KJV] 5 Open rebuke [is] better than secret love. It is written: [Heb 12:5-6 KJV] 5 And ye have forgotten the exhortation which speaketh unto you as unto children, My son, despise not thou the chastening of the Lord, nor faint when thou art rebuked of him: 6 For whom the Lord loveth he chasteneth, and scourgeth every son whom he receiveth.
